A top-ranked quarterback just signed a 5-year contract, providing $3 million per year, payable at the end of each month. A hockey superstar accepts a 5-year contract, with a $4 million signing bonus, payable immediately and $2.1 million per year, payable at the end of each month. The quarterback brags that his contract is better because he is getting $15 million and the hockey player is getting only $14.5 million. Is the quarterback right? The interest rate is 8%, EAR.
